Ylan Guerin Pozzalo Notches Top-5 Finish at Border Olympics

The freshman from Bourg St. Maurice, France finished eight strokes under par for the tournament.

LAREDO, Texas -- Ylan Guerin Pozzalo completed his first tournament of the spring tied for fifth in the final results as the ULM men's golf team competed at the 2024 Border Olympics in Laredo, Texas.

As a team, the Warhawks finished ninth out of 17 teams after shooting an 854 (282-286-286) in the three-round tournament.

Guerin Pozzalo fired 208 strokes in three rounds after totaling 70 in round one, 68 in round two and 70 in round three. He completed the tournament with 12 birdies, one eagle and 36 pars. Melan Dhaubhadel finished under par in all three of his rounds for a tournament score of 212, which was a tie for 15th place. Dhaubhadel's best round came in the second round of the tournament when he fired a 70. Theis Poulsen recorded a pair of even-par rounds after scoring his best round of the week with a score of one-under par in the third round. Poulsen tallied 215 total strokes in a tie for 26th place. Mikkel Schmitt (228) and Hayes Hamilt rounded out the scoring for the Warhawks.

Illinois State captured the tournament championship after shooting an 832. Lipscomb, North Texas and Rice tied for second with a total of 848. Five teams were separated by two strokes. Houston, Michigan and Sam Houston all accumulated 852 while Troy totaled 853, one stroke less than ULM.

The Warhawks are back in action Sunday (Feb. 25) at the UNCG Dorado Beach Collegiate Tournament at Dorado Beach, Puerto Rico.
